Business as Mission (BAM)

Part of our Small Business Development (SBD) strategy

Business as Mission is one of the primary ways we live out our Small Business Development work.
While SBD is the broader strategy, BAM is how it takes shape—through real businesses that serve people, create opportunity, and support ministry in everyday life.

Business as Mission engages in God’s work through sustainable, ethical enterprises. These businesses create jobs, build meaningful relationships, and reflect Christ’s love in practical ways. Through this approach, people are empowered, communities are strengthened, and the Gospel is lived out in both word and action.

Small Business Development (SBD) is the strategy. Business as Mission (BAM) is one way that strategy is lived out.


Equipping Leaders Through Small Business Development

Small Business Development (SBD) is the foundation that equips leaders to engage in ministry through business.

Through SBD, evangelical Friends churches around the world receive practical training that prepares pastors, evangelists, and church planters to start and sustain businesses as part of their ministry.

Business as Mission (BAM) is one expression of this work, where those skills are put into practice through real businesses that create opportunity, build relationships, and open doors to share Christ.

This approach not only supports ministry but also strengthens local communities through meaningful, sustainable work.


What This Looks Like in Practice

Through this approach, leaders are able to:

  • Launch small businesses that support their ministry
  • Create jobs within their communities
  • Build relationships with people who may not otherwise engage with the church
  • Demonstrate the love of Christ through daily work and interaction

Each business becomes more than an income source—it becomes a platform for ministry, discipleship, and long-term community impact.

Working Together for Greater Impact

We partner with global disciples because of their proven approach to Small Business Development (SBD) as a tool for ministry and church planting. Through this partnership, leaders are equipped with practical skills that allow them to sustain themselves, serve their communities, and share the gospel through everyday work. This model creates lasting impact because:

  • Business creates natural, daily opportunities to build relationships and share Christ with those who may never enter a church
  • Leaders can support themselves and their families, reducing dependence on outside funding
  • People with business skills can directly engage in mission, using their experience to strengthen both ministry and community

Together, this approach equips leaders and empowers local churches to grow in ways that are both spiritually and economically sustainable.
